Output f69defb6de5cc84ddabc2e023e79048ae04a20606d631945e619ffd3abaf8b4a:183

value
52658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8f6c661b1f569ba5edbcf4031156730c2da80ec OP_EQUAL
address
3H6R4zbdadDYQ36Fnp6rMPVLkiH6LjvB8H
transaction
f69defb6de5cc84ddabc2e023e79048ae04a20606d631945e619ffd3abaf8b4a